projects
/
lcr.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Add GSM HR reference codec that is automatically downloaded from 3gpp.org
[lcr.git]
/
lcrsocket.h
diff --git
a/lcrsocket.h
b/lcrsocket.h
index
edb882b
..
f52dd7e
100644
(file)
--- a/
lcrsocket.h
+++ b/
lcrsocket.h
@@
-39,6
+39,7
@@
enum { /* messages */
ADMIN_CALL_DISCONNECT,
ADMIN_CALL_RELEASE,
ADMIN_CALL_NOTIFY,
ADMIN_CALL_DISCONNECT,
ADMIN_CALL_RELEASE,
ADMIN_CALL_NOTIFY,
+ ADMIN_CALL_PROGRESS,
ADMIN_TRACE_REQUEST,
ADMIN_TRACE_RESPONSE,
ADMIN_MESSAGE,
ADMIN_TRACE_REQUEST,
ADMIN_TRACE_RESPONSE,
ADMIN_MESSAGE,
@@
-82,6
+83,8
@@
struct admin_response_interface {
char busy[256]; /* if port is idle(0) busy(1) */
unsigned int port[256]; /* current port */
int mode[256];
char busy[256]; /* if port is idle(0) busy(1) */
unsigned int port[256]; /* current port */
int mode[256];
+ char out_channel[256];
+ char in_channel[256];
};
struct admin_response_remote {
};
struct admin_response_remote {
@@
-92,6
+95,7
@@
struct admin_response_join {
unsigned int serial; /* join serial number */
char remote[32]; /* remote application name */
unsigned int partyline;
unsigned int serial; /* join serial number */
char remote[32]; /* remote application name */
unsigned int partyline;
+ unsigned int threepty;
};
struct admin_response_epoint {
};
struct admin_response_epoint {
@@
-130,7
+134,7
@@
struct admin_call {
int present; /* presentation */
int cause; /* cause to send */
int location;
int present; /* presentation */
int cause; /* cause to send */
int location;
- int notify;
+ int notify
_progress
;
int bc_capa;
int bc_mode;
int bc_info1;
int bc_capa;
int bc_mode;
int bc_info1;
@@
-188,4
+192,5
@@
enum {
ADMIN_STATE_CONNECT,
ADMIN_STATE_IN_DISCONNECT,
ADMIN_STATE_OUT_DISCONNECT,
ADMIN_STATE_CONNECT,
ADMIN_STATE_IN_DISCONNECT,
ADMIN_STATE_OUT_DISCONNECT,
+ ADMIN_STATE_RELEASE,
};
};